Home energy assessment

Get ready to discover the potential for energy savings in your home through a personalized home energy assessment. This assessment is a crucial step in understanding the efficiency of your home and identifying areas where improvements can be made.

One key aspect that’ll be evaluated during the assessment is air sealing. Air sealing involves closing up any gaps or cracks in your home’s exterior that allow air to leak in or out. These leaks can significantly impact energy efficiency by allowing conditioned air to escape and outdoor air to enter, causing your heating and cooling systems to work harder.

During the assessment, a professional will use specialized equipment to detect these leaks and determine their size and location. Based on this information, they’ll provide recommendations for sealing these gaps, which can include weatherstripping doors and windows, caulking around pipes and vents, and insulating attics and crawlspaces.

By addressing air leaks through proper sealing techniques identified during a home energy assessment, you can greatly improve energy efficiency in your home while reducing utility expenses.

Home Energy Assessment Process

Discover how you can maximize your home’s energy savings with a comprehensive assessment process. A home energy assessment process is essential to identify areas where you can improve insulation and air sealing. By evaluating your home’s energy usage, certified professionals can pinpoint specific areas that need attention.

Here are three key steps involved in the assessment:

  • Thorough Inspection: Professionals will meticulously assess your home’s insulation levels, inspecting walls, ceilings, floors, and attics for any gaps or leaks that compromise energy efficiency.
  • Blower Door Test: This test helps determine the amount of air leakage in your home by creating a pressure difference using a powerful fan. It reveals hidden air leaks and aids in prioritizing sealing efforts.
  • Infrared Imaging: With specialized cameras, technicians detect temperature variations on surfaces caused by inadequate insulation or air infiltration, providing valuable insights into problem areas.

The precise information gathered during the home energy assessment process enables you to make informed decisions about improving insulation and air sealing, resulting in enhanced energy efficiency and significant cost savings over time.

Door Test

One way to evaluate the effectiveness of your home’s insulation and air sealing is through a simple door test. This test involves closing all windows and exterior doors in your home and turning off any fans or ventilation systems. Then, you light an incense stick or hold a tissue near the edges of your closed exterior doors. If the smoke from the incense stick wafts or if the tissue moves, it indicates that there is air leakage around the door.

This means that your home’s insulation and air sealing may not be working efficiently, leading to energy loss and decreased energy efficiency. By identifying these areas of air leakage, you can take steps to improve insulation and seal gaps, such as applying weatherstripping or caulking around doors to create a tighter seal.

Conducting regular door tests can help ensure optimal energy efficiency in your home by pinpointing areas for improvement.
